TOMS RIVER, NJ — The start of the 2021-22 school year has brought its share of challenges, and in the Toms River Regional School District, a bus driver shortage has led to multiple problems, including the rescheduling of some sports events.

The district has two students recognized as National Merit Scholarship semifinalists.
